Arnaud Faye
Chef de cuisine at Le Bristol Paris
With a deep appreciation for France's diverse regions and their culinary traditions, Arnaud Faye understands that truly great food comes from a commitment to local, artisanal producers. He places his trust in those who cultivate the land with respect, ensuring the highest quality ingredients.


Arnaud Faye's culinary journey began in the heart of the Auvergne. Growing up surrounded by the earth's bounty, he developed a deep appreciation for fresh produce and natural flavours.
Trained under renowned Chefs like Antoine Westermann and Bernard Loiseau, Faye honed his skills in creating complex sauces and celebrating regional delicacies. His talent led him to prestigious positions at the Ritz Paris and L'Auberge du Jeu de Paume, where he earned Michelin stars for his innovative cuisine.
In Èze, at the Château de la Chèvre d'or, Arnaud Faye continued to elevate his culinary artistry, earning two Michelin stars for his Mediterranean-inspired dishes. His commitment to excellence was recognised in 2019 when he was awarded the prestigious title of Meilleur Ouvrier de France.
